An interlocal agreement passed by Orting Valley Fire and Rescue (Pierce Co. Fire District 18) Board of Commissioners June 25 would extend the service of East Pierce Fire and Rescue Assistant Chief Dave Wakefield as interim chief.

Wakefield has been acting chief since late May after District 18 Fire Chief Randy Shelton was placed a 30-day administrative leave.

East Pierce Fire Chief Jerry Thorson said the agreement hasn't been signed, but attorneys from both district nust meet to discuss several items before the agreement is ready.

"The interlocal simply formalizes our agreement to help while their chief is on leave," said Thorson. "Chief Wakefield is continuing to help out for now."

During Thursday's special meeting of District 18 commissioners, they announced a list of seven formal charges against Shelton.

The District 18 Board of Commissioners will meet July 7 at the Orting Public Safety Building.
